![]() I can't see Jackson taking the job with the Knicks as the team is presently constructed. One thing Jackson did very well was choose to take jobs where he knew he would be successful. This team doesn't have a MJ and Pippen or Kobe and Shaq. It has a very bad owner. It has no draft picks and a small amount of cap space. And it has a guy who is a ball stopper as the primary focus of the offense. It has a max contract guy with bad knees who isn't moving very well. It has no point guard, no back up point guard, no depth, no defensive stopper, no scoring off the bench. The cap situation is shaky and with Chicago and Miami both looking considerably better than NY I just don't think Phil's gonna jump into a situation for this first time in his career.
